I went into the theater with mediocre expectations, and I was rewarded with an above average television movie of the week with slightly above average acting. A really toned down storyline, with really fabulous characters who didn't come across as all that fabulous. Seth Green was the high point of the movie, and I must say that Mac did an all right job...at least he didn't smack his face and scream, m-kay? The biggest flaw that I observed was the below average screenplay...it was quite...choppy and distracting. Jumping from one scene to the next without much cohesion, but that might just be me, I'm a writer, and I expect a lot, and am quite often disappointed because of this. Overall, I enjoyed the film...loved Diana Scarwid in yet another campy movie. Not quite a camp classic, but close. Two and one half stars. See it if you have nothing else planned, like getting a pedicure or transforming yourself into a stunning six foot chicken. |
